Background
The adsorption cabinet is an environment-friendly device for filtering and adsorbing harmful and peculiar smell gases. The activated carbon adsorption cabinet has the advantages of high adsorption efficiency, wide application range, convenient maintenance, capability of treating various mixed waste gases simultaneously and the like, and the activated carbon adsorption recovery device can adsorb and recover the waste gases of organic solvents such as benzene, alcohol, ketone, ether, alkane, aldehyde, phenol, gasoline and the like, is suitable for treating the organic waste gases with large air quantity and low concentration, and can be selected in the industries such as chemical industry, light industry, machinery, printing, rubber, furniture, electromechanics, ships, automobiles, petroleum and the like. In practical use, the adsorption cabinet has the defects of large volume, inconvenient movement and poor adsorption effect, so that a portable movable adsorption cabinet is urgently needed to solve the problems.

The utility model provides a portable movable adsorption cabinet as shown in figures 1-3, which comprises a cabinet body 1, an air inlet main pipe 2 and an air purifying device 3, wherein one side of the cabinet body 1 is provided with an air inlet 16, a first fan 17 is fixed in the cabinet body 1, the first fan 17 is arranged corresponding to the air inlet 16, negative pressure is formed in the cabinet body 1 through the operation of the first fan 17, further air outside the cabinet body 1 is sucked into the cabinet body 1 through the air inlet 16, the air inlet main pipe 2 is arranged along the vertical direction, the bottom end of the air inlet main pipe is fixedly connected with the air inlet 16 through a flange plate, the top end of the air inlet main pipe 2 is connected with an air inlet branch pipe 21 through a rotary sealing joint, one end of the air inlet branch pipe 21 is provided with a gas collecting hood 22, dust and waste gas are conveniently guided into the air inlet branch pipe 21 to prevent the diffusion of the dust and the waste gas, a mounting plate 18 is arranged in the horizontal direction in the cabinet body 1, the air purifying device 3 is arranged on the upper surface of the mounting plate 18, the air purifying device 3 comprises a first filter 31, a separation frame 32 and a second filter 33 which are arranged from bottom to top, and a second fan 321 and a gas sensor 322 are arranged in the separation frame 32.
In addition, the cabinet body 1 is the cuboid structure, and the bolt fastening has top cap 10 at the top of the cabinet body 1, can prevent that debris from getting into the cabinet body 1 in, also can protect air purification device 3 simultaneously and avoid the collision, and the bottom four corners department of the cabinet body 1 is fixed with universal wheel 19, the convenient removal.
Specifically, one side top of the cabinet body 1 is equipped with switch 11 respectively, warning light 12, function panel 13 and siren 14, switch 11, warning light 12 and siren 14 all with function panel 13 electric connection, wherein, switch 11's the other end is connected with external power source, warning light 12 and siren 14 remind the staff to change the filter through lamp light sum alarm sound respectively, function panel 13 includes display screen and function button, all the other side tops of the cabinet body 1 all are equipped with a plurality of venthole 15, conveniently will purify the air exhaust cabinet body 1, in addition, function panel 13's medial surface electric connection has the singlechip, stop through opening of each electronic parts of singlechip control and be prior art, do not describe here any more.
It is worth mentioning that, the inlet main pipe 2 is connected through rotary seal joint with inlet branch pipe 21, rotary seal joint is right angle joint, make inlet branch pipe 21 can carry out 360 rotations around the inlet main pipe 2 and its self also can carry out 360 rotations simultaneously, the inlet main pipe 2 and inlet branch pipe 21 remain encapsulated situation throughout in the rotatory in-process, conveniently adjust the position of gas collecting channel 22, make the working face can be aimed at to gas collecting channel 22, be favorable to improving waste gas absorption effect, prevent simultaneously that waste gas from taking place to reveal at the in-process that is inhaled cabinet body 1, inlet branch pipe 21 passes through screw thread fixed connection with gas collecting channel 22, and has stable in structure, install and remove convenient and the effectual advantage of gas collection.
Specifically, mounting panel 18 is the latticed structure of rectangle, makes things convenient for waste gas to pass through mounting panel 18 and gets into first filter 31, and the four sides of mounting panel 18 respectively with the medial surface welding of the cabinet body 1, and the structure is firm, and mounting panel 18 is located between venthole 15 and first fan 17 for the net gas device 3 that sets up at the 18 upper surface of mounting panel also is located between venthole 15 and the first fan 17, ensures that waste gas purifies earlier after getting into the cabinet body 1 and discharges.
It should be noted that the cross-sectional dimensions of the first filter 31, the separation frame 32, and the second filter 33 are all the same as the cross-sectional dimension of the mounting plate 18, so that the exhaust gas passing through the mounting plate 18 can completely pass through the first filter 31 and the second filter 33, and the exhaust gas is prevented from escaping without being purified, and the first filter 31 and the second filter 33 are both activated carbon filters, and the activated carbon has a large specific surface area, strong adsorption performance, and good adsorption effect.
Specifically, the separating frame 32 is a cuboid structure without a top cover, so that the gas filtered by the first filter 31 can enter the second filter 33 conveniently, the bottom of the separating frame 32 is provided with a through hole matched with the second fan 321, so that the second fan 321 can attract the waste gas at the bottom of the cabinet body 1 upwards conveniently, the waste gas is guided to pass through the first filter 31, the gas sensor 322 is electrically connected with the functional panel 13, the gas sensor 322 can monitor the gas components passing through the first filter 31 in real time, when the gas contains toxic and harmful components, it is described that the first filter 31 is saturated by adsorption, at the moment, the toxic and harmful component information in the gas is displayed on the functional panel 13, meanwhile, the functional panel 13 automatically controls the alarm lamp 12 and the alarm 14 to start, so as to remind a worker to replace the first filter 31 in time, when the first filter 31 is replaced, the first filter 31 is replaced by the original second filter 33, then, a new filter is installed at the original second filter 33, so that the filter can be fully utilized and consumables can be saved.
The working principle is as follows: when the portable movable adsorption cabinet is used, firstly, the cabinet body 1 is moved to an experimental site, then the air inlet branch pipe 21 is rotated to enable the air collecting hood 22 to be positioned right above an exhaust gas source, then the switch 11 is started, at the moment, the first fan 17 and the second fan 321 are started simultaneously, exhaust gas generated by the exhaust gas source enters the cabinet body 1 through the air collecting hood 22, the air inlet branch pipe 21 and the air inlet main pipe 2, then the exhaust gas moves upwards under the action of the second fan 321 and sequentially passes through the first filter 31 and the second filter 33, the exhaust gas is discharged out of the cabinet body through the air outlet 15 after being filtered twice, after the first filter 31 is adsorbed and saturated, the exhaust gas passing through the first filter 31 is insufficiently filtered, at the moment, the gas sensor 322 detects that the gas passing through the first filter 31 contains toxic and harmful components, the gas sensor 322 displays the toxic and harmful components on the display screen of the functional panel 13, then the functional panel 13 starts the alarm lamp 12 and the alarm 14, reminding the staff to replace the filter in time.
